As a disciple of Jesus, you learn from Jesus.


You learn by growing in a personal relationship with him. Jesus is alive and desires a personal
relationship with you. Day by day and moment by moment he is interested in you and interacts with
you through his Word, The Bible, and through His Holy Spirit. He loves to show us his love for us and
to teach us the best most exciting way to live. His desire is that we learn about his kingdom and live by
faith with Jesus Christ as our Lord.

Jesus is Lord- Trust in HIM


It is important to be able to distinguish the difference between believing that Jesus is real and living a
life of putting your faith in him. Believing that God exists and is who the Bible says he is, is fantastic.
Jesus asks you to do more than that. Put your faith in him -believe in Jesus, trust Jesus Christ as your
Lord.

Having Jesus as Lord is like allowing him to take the ‘steering wheel’ of your life. We are normally used
to being ‘the boss’ of our own life. We have the steering wheel and make all the decisions about what
we think about and say, and even what actions and attitudes we have. Giving Jesus Lordship is
surrendering our will to allow him to lead and shape us in
every area of our life. He is a good God. He has our very
best in mind. We can trust him.

Believe that Jesus is your Saviour- He has saved you from


your sin.
Also believe and live with Jesus as your Lord.

Final thought for the lesson

Decide today to finish well.


Choosing to live with Jesus as your Lord and Saviour is an awesome and exciting decision. Even more
important than choosing to live for Jesus today, is choosing to still be living for Jesus -everyday.

In the Bible, Paul speaks about the Christian life as like a race. Many people may start
to run in a marathon. It takes determination to finish the marathon race. God is on
your side. Allow God to help you everyday. Living a life of faith in Jesus Christ is
exciting. You can't do it alone, but with God by your side YOU CAN!
When you are born again you are a child of God. Others who are born again are your
family- God’s family. You can encourage and support one another. Starting well, living
well, and finishing well are all made easier if we do it alongside family. Jesus is LORD!
You can choose to live an exciting life with him. Choose also to encourage, love, and
support those who walk with you.
